Special Weather Statement issued July 20 at 11:43AM CDT by NWS Quad Cities IA IL

Details

At 1142 AM CDT, trained weather spotters reported strong
thunderstorms along a line extending from near Montpelier to near
Fruitland to near Riverside. Movement was southeast at 45 mph.

HAZARD…Wind gusts up to 50 mph.

SOURCE…Trained weather spotters.

IMPACT…Strong winds could break small tree limbs and blow around
unsecured objects.

Locations impacted include…
Muscatine, Aledo, Wapello, Columbus Junction, Burgess, Kalona, Lone
Tree, Andalusia, Riverside, Fruitland, Viola, Morning Sun,
Millersburg, Matherville, New Boston, Keithsburg, Grandview,
Reynolds, Conesville, and Eliza.

Instructions

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.

Torrential rainfall is occurring and may lead to localized flooding.
Do not drive your vehicle through flooded roadways.

Frequent cloud to ground lightning is occurring with these storms.
Lightning can strike 10 miles away from a thunderstorm. Seek a safe
shelter inside a building or vehicle.
